Book excerpt: "This investigation sought to explore the reasons behind the success of the Anglo-American "grand alliance" of World War II, and, in particular, examined the importance of the military collaboration that took place before the entry of the United States into the war. Specifically, the study questioned whether the prewar efforts at collaboration made a vital difference which paid off in terms of substantially more effective cooperation after Pearl Harbor"--Abstract.
